Why Your Bags Lose Shape
Ever pulled a bag out of storage and found it looking sadâ€â€collapsed sides, drooping handles, creased bases? That’s gravity winning.
When bags sit empty for weeks or months, they lose structural integrity. Leather softens and sags. Canvas wrinkles. Straps stress at attachment points. The bag slowly “forgets†its original shape.

How Bag Shapers Actually Work
Think of a handbag shaper as a custom pillow for your bagâ€â€designed specifically for long-term support.
The Science: Empty bags collapse inward due to external pressure from stacking or hanging. A shaper provides internal counter-pressure, preserving the bag’s three-dimensional structure.
The Material: We use velvet because it is:
- Soft enough to avoid stressing seams or stretching leather
- Firm enough to maintain support over time
- Breathable to allow air circulation and prevent mold
- Moisture-absorbing to control internal humidity
- Gentle on delicate silk or suede linings
The Fill: Premium fiber fill strikes the perfect balanceâ€â€supportive but not rigid, lightweight yet substantial, breathable but dense enough to hold shape.

FAQs
Can I use tissue paper or bubble wrap instead?
Not recommended. Tissue creates pressure points, bubble wrap traps moisture, and newspaper ink can transfer. Purpose-made shapers are breathable, supportive, and safe for all materials.
How do I choose the right shaper size?
Measure your bag’s interior width and choose a shaper 2–3cm smaller. It should support without forcing the bag open.
Do I need a shaper if I use my bag regularly?
Yes. Insert the shaper overnight or during weekends to allow shape recovery. Seasonal bags should always be stored with shapers.
